documented disabilities. Note taking as an accommodation may be appropriate for students with a hearing or visual impairment, a motor or physical limitation or an attentional or learning disability. Through supplementing note takers' notes to their own notes, students have the opportunity to fully engage with in-class content.

Note-taking accommodations are not a replacement for class attendance. Note-taking accommodations helps remove barriers to learning by augmenting student note-taking skills and ensuring access to information presented in class. Note taking is an accommodation that captures important pieces of information in a systematic way. While most commonly used in the classroom, it can be used in any situation requiring learning, including job sites and internships. Apply to Note Taker, Accommodation Assistant, Student Researcher and more!Glean is a note taking app that is made from the Sonocent Audio Notetaker Creators. Gleans note taking software enables you to sync lecture slides to an audio recording while also having the option to type notes. Glean has a transcription feature that allows you to convert your audio recording to text. The note taker should be seated in a position where he/she can hear the instructor and any other speakers in the room. The note taker and the student should sit in a position where there is no glare on the laptop screens.
